1. ホーム
  2. oracle

[解決済み] ORA 00936 Missing Expression Error を解決するにはどうしたらいいですか?

2022-03-06 02:21:09

質問

Select /*+USE_HASH( a b ) */ to_char(date, 'MM/DD/YYYY HH24:MI:SS') as LABEL,
ltrim(rtrim(substr(oled, 9, 16))) as VALUE,
from rrfh a, rrf b,
where ltrim(rtrim(substr(oled, 1, 9))) = 'stata kish' 
and a.xyz = b.xyz 

上記のクエリの "from " (3行目) の部分は、以下のようになります。 ORA-00936 Missing EXPRESSION error . 助けてください

ノート :: rrfh テーブルにデータがありません。

解決方法は?

コンマを削除しますか?

select /*+USE_HASH( a b ) */ to_char(date, 'MM/DD/YYYY HH24:MI:SS') as LABEL,
ltrim(rtrim(substr(oled, 9, 16))) as VALUE
from rrfh a, rrf b
where ltrim(rtrim(substr(oled, 1, 9))) = 'stata kish' 
and a.xyz = b.xyz

をご覧ください。 フロム

複数のテーブルから選択する 複数のテーブルを テーブルをリストアップすることで、FROM句 の間にカンマを入れ、各テーブル 名前